Baked Asparagus with Lemon, Butter and Parmesan
Prep time: 10 mins Cook time: 15 mins Total time: 25 mins
Author: Natasha of NatashasKitchen.com
Skill Level: Easy
Cost To Make: $5
Serving: 6-8
Ingredients
2 bunches asparagus
1 lemon
4 Tbsp butter
Olive oil
Salt & Pepper
½ cup shredded Parmesan cheese
Instructions
Rinse 2 bunches of asparagus and break off the ends by holding the base end and snapping it wherever it snaps.
Place asparagus in a large baking dish, dr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le lightly with salt and pepper.
Squeeze ½ of a lemon over the asparagus. Line the top third of the asparagus with lemon slices from the other half of your lemon (optional).
Thinly slice 4 tbsp of butter and line the center of the asparagus with butter.
Bake at 400°F for 12 minutes or until asparagus is tender. Remove asparagus from the oven and set oven to Broil.
Sprinkle the center of the asparagus with Parmesan cheese and broil 2-3 minutes or until cheese is melted and golden.

Uncle Ben's Wild Rice with Cranberries and Pecans
This side dish is so easy and tastes great! I have made it for Thanksgiving because it can be made in advance, put aside, and then served at room temperature.
1 package Uncle Ben's Wild Rice
Follow directions on box using chicken broth for liquid and 1/2 of the seasoning package.
Simmer, covered, for 20 minutes and then remove lid for five minutes
Let cool
To cooled rice add:
1/3 cup chopped celery
1/3 cup chopped green onions
1/2 cup dried cranberries
1/2 cup toasted pecans ( 350 oven for 6 minutes, break apart with hands)
3 Tablespoons olive oil
2 Tablespoons balsamic vinegar
salt and pepper to taste
Serve room temperature

Salisbury Steak
4 Servings
1 (10 3/4 oz.) can cream of mushroom soup, divided (undiluted)
1 lb. hamburger
1 cup Italian seasoned dry bread crumbs
1/2 cup chopped onion
1 egg, beaten
1 tsp. salt
pepper to taste
1 Tbsp. Worcestershire sauce
2 Tbsp. water
1 (8 oz.) can mushroom stems and pieces, drained
Combine 1/4 cup soup, ground beef, bread crumbs, onion, egg, salt and pepper in a large bowl; don't overmix. Shape into 4 patties and place in a greased 9-inch baking pan. Combine the remaining soup with Worcestershire sauce, water and mushrooms; spread the mixture evenly over the patties. Bake uncovered at 350° for 60 minutes.
